Product Overview
PUEM2 2.4-2.8m Passive Underground Electronic Marker is full range disk underground electronic marker is suitable for marking underground facilities with large burial depths, such as high-pressure gas pipelines, long-distance optical cables, etc..The FCST-PUEM2 disk marker is designed and produced according to international standard frequencies, and is compatible with electronic marker locators designed and produced according to international standard frequencies. Installations
The disc electronic marker should be installed above the pipeline and kept as horizontal as possible. The non-metallic pipe should be directly attached to the pipeline and fixed with ties. When covering the soil, sand or sand should be used to fill the gap between the marker and the pipeline to avoid uneven force on the marker after covering the soil. Considering the uncertainty of the later soil cover thickness, it is generally recommended that the burial depth be less than 80% of the maximum detectable depth of the model. To avoid mutual interference between markers, the distance between two adjacent markers should be greater than 1.5 meters.FCST-PUEM2 Electronic Marker Datesheet. Do not press the marker under the pipeline or the marked object. If it is a metal pipe, the marker should be kept at a distance of no less than 12CM from the top of the pipe, and there should be no metal objects covering the marker.
